Nonprofit Update

  • Next steps:
    • Sign and submit the Articles of Incorporation!! Woot!
      • Once the State of Indiana files those, the new entity is "born"
      • Start to transfer items from the LLC to the nonprofit
    • Finalize Bylaws (NGO lawyer wrote these based on Boston conversation)
    • Approve Board
    • Submit application to IRS

Road Map Summer Conference

  • Why? Next Road Map Conference may not occur til 2012, if we host in South East Asia which is too long to wait
  • Dates: late June, mid to late July
    • 3-5 days
  • Topics: opportunity to bring core implementations together with developers to build momentum
    • Burke - Strategy and Design
      • Strategy: things we're planning on the road map are planned out, prioritized correctly, and meeting implementers' needs
  • Next Steps:
    • Dawn is connecting with individuals at Columbia University about hosting the conference
    • Dawn will send concept paper to Andy to circulate with Columbia for conference support
